Motor Vehicles

The motor is at the heart of the treadmill. It is responsible for converting electrical energy into movement that moves the belt. It also regulates the speed and incline. Knowing more about the motor can help you understand the specifications of a treadmill and ensure it will support your fitness goals.

Like any engine treadmill motor functions differently based on its size and voltage as well as its wattage. The bigger the motor, the more powerful it is and the more quickly it will run. This is because the motor needs to perform harder to overcome the force of your stride when you walk, jog or run.

The treadmill's motor does not always last longer simply because it has more power. The life span of a treadmill is affected by a number of factors, including the quality of the motor, its usage and maintenance schedule.

The manufacturer's warranty can also give you indications of how reliable and durable a treadmill is. Warranty periods under five years are usually indicative of a motor that is not up to par and won't last for long. While warranties between 10 and lifetime are of high-end quality and last for a long time.

AC motors are generally more durable than DC motors. Due to their more proneness to heat buildup, the latter are more likely than the former to suffer from issues such as bearing failure and overheating. If you're planning to use a treadmill for commercial purposes, an AC motor is the best way to go.

Deck

The deck is the place where your feet are when you walk or run. A quality deck should be strong enough to withstand your body weight without warping or breaking. The deck should be smooth and lubricated to prevent the belt from slipping during use. Most manufacturers provide an assurance on decks and a maintenance kit. Certain decks require flipping and lubricated from time time.

A deck made of top quality should be at least 20" wide to accommodate your foot. A narrow deck is uncomfortable for runners who take long strides. It's also essential to ensure that the walking belt is centered on the deck. As time passes, it's not uncommon to notice treadmill walking belts move from one side to the other. This can cause the belt to slide along the deck rails making it difficult to maintain a steady pace. Many treadmill companies provide easy-to-follow videos to assist you in locating your belt.

Cushioning

Many people buy treadmills to get an at-home cardio workout that is less strain on joints than running outdoors. The deck on which the belt slides typically has a special technology that cushions it and lessen the impact. Cushioning is usually made from EVA foam or rubber, though certain manufacturers employ springs. The frame of the treadmill is usually more robust than other machines. This makes it more durable and less likely for it to be dented.
